American Range Gas Charbroilers - AECB-36 

36" Wide • 105,000 BTU • Gas (Natural or LP)

Bring unmistakable steakhouse flavor to your menu with the AECB-36. Three robust cast-iron “H” burners heat natural volcanic lava rocks, creating sizzling flames and savory smoke that seal in juices and boost every bite with authentic char-broiled taste—all from a compact, easy-to-clean countertop package that’s built in the USA.

Features                    
  • True char-broiled flavor—juices vaporize on the lava rocks for intense smoky aroma.
  • (3) Individually controlled cast-iron “H” burners, 35,000 BTU/hr each (105,000 BTU total).
  • Standing pilots and smooth-turn manual gas valves for instant, reliable ignition.
  • Heavy-duty reversible cast-iron grates with built-in grease runners; position flat or sloped to tame flare-ups.
  • Full-length grease channel drains to a removable stainless steel pan for fast clean-up.
  • Stainless steel front & sides with a fully insulated double-wall chassis for durability in high-volume kitchens.
  • 4" chrome-plated legs lift the broiler for airflow and easy countertop sanitation.
  • Field-convertible for Natural or Propane gas—simply specify at time of order.
Specifications
Model AECB-36
Overall Dimensions (W × D × H) 36" × 24" × 13-1/4" (914 × 610 × 337 mm)
Cooking Surface 36" × 24" (914 × 610 mm)
Number of Burners 3 cast-iron “H” burners
Total Heat Input 105,000 BTU/hr (30.0 kW)
Gas Connection 3/4" NPT, rear
Manifold Pressure Natural Gas 5.0" W.C. • Propane 10.0" W.C.
Lava Rock Natural volcanic rock included
Grates Reversible heavy-duty cast iron, removable in sections

Maintenance Tips      
  • Brush and clean cooking grates daily while warm to remove carbon buildup and maintain strong sear performance.
  • Empty and clean grease tray frequently to prevent flare-ups and fire hazards.
  • Inspect burners and ports regularly; clean with a soft brush to ensure even flame and proper gas flow.
  • Check lava rock or radiant components (if equipped) and replace or clean as needed to maintain heat efficiency.
  • Wipe stainless steel surfaces with a mild, non-abrasive cleaner to prevent corrosion and preserve finish.
  • Ensure proper gas pressure and ignition performance by keeping pilot assemblies clean and unobstructed.
  • Avoid heavy grease accumulation under the unit—clean interior and drip areas routinely for safety.
  • Never use water directly on hot grates or burners to avoid damage and warping.
  • Schedule periodic professional servicing to maintain high-BTU output and long-term durability.
